Grid server technology never made any sense to begin with. It suffers from multiple design failures; What happens when too many players are at corner of a grid cell? IT will have to divide endlessly and spawn hundreds of servers to divide region. Each server creating proxy actors will put just as much load on individual servers and still end up being limited by single node performance on dense battles.
Instead of wasting energy working on tech that is fundementally flawed they should have went old-school single node server style with modern hardware that has over 300 cores in single node to achieve scale.
But since you are worried about this, Epic Games (makers of Unreal) are already working on similar server meshing tech for Unreal Engine. Needless to say, with their endless resources and engineering expertise they will do much better job than Intrepids grid servers. And since it is being built onto Unreal it won't be exclusive to one company.
Since "the old way" of doing it was that the game world was divided up in to chunks, and each chunk given its own hardware node, trying to allocate hardware powerful enough to handle the size combat Ashes was supposed to have, to each chunk of the world the size Verra was supposed to be would have been prohibitively expensive.

I think you are missing my point, even with dynamic gridding, hardware won't hold. You simply cannot have the "size of combat Ashes was supposed to have". A meshing tech that relies on proxy actors does not scale linearly, it scales logarithmically. Only linear scaling you can get out of servers is simply by having more powerful hardware. Any form of vertical scaling hits logarithmic scaling limits and very fast unless you do it WoW style (can't see players on other nodes)
This is why, when making game design, you simply cannot be idealistic and ignore how underlying hardware will operate (like what AoC did and what Star Citizen is doing right now). Your game design needs to revolve around hardware and tech limitations. I'd rather have an MMO that can support 200v200 guild wars that actually ends up releasing and working fine instead of an MMO that was supposed to support 5000v5000 but only implodes during Alpha. This is why Albion succeeded, because instead of chasing fancy tech dreams that are inherently flawed, they designed everything around hardware.
I also think you are vastly overestimating how much it costs to have powerful processors nowadays. Fastest CPU you can buy for this right now is AMD EPYC 9755, that goes around for 13K$. That is the kind of processor that won't sweat holding 5.000 players on a single node and that is a very conservative estimate. Compared to sub-fee those players will pay for month (completely ignoring that they won't even be online 7/24) it is cheap AF. And obviously once you purchase it will run for a decade with less than 1% failure rate.
